This vintage 1952 Lord Elgin pocket watch is a one-of-a-kind piece that truly captures the essence of classic timepieces. With features such as Arabic numerals, an acrylic crystal, and a 12-hour dial, this watch is both stylish and functional. The watch is made of yellow gold and has a polished finish that gives it a sleek look. The case is 14K solid gold. The movement is unserviced but winds, sets and runs properly.

The pocket watch has a special connection to the automotive world, as it was awarded to Edward G. Day for his service with Chevrolet from 1928 to 1954. The watch is personalized with his name, making it a unique item for any collector or fan of Chevrolet history. This mechanical (manual) watch is not water-resistant and comes without papers or service records.
